Marine Harvest to Install Algae Barriers in Chilean Pens; Forecasts 6% Bump to Global 2017 Output
SEAFOODNEWS.COM by Michael Ramsingh - December 30, 2016
Marine Harvest Chile has invested in technologies that will mitigate the risk of algae blooms at its farmed salmon operations. The company also issued a forecast for higher salmon production out of its Chilean farms.
The company will spend $1.5 million on mitigation technology that prevents the spread of toxic algae to its ponds. Marine Harvest uses a similar system at its Canadian operations...
